In the context of data management, what is often crucial for implementing data governance?

Defining a clear data strategy is crucial for implementing data governance because it serves as the foundation upon which all data-related activities are built. A well-defined data strategy outlines how data will be managed, utilized, and governed across the organization, ensuring that all stakeholders understand the purpose and direction for data management initiatives. This strategic framework helps to align data governance efforts with business goals, facilitating better decision-making and enhancing overall data quality.

By articulating a clear vision for how data should be treated within the organization, a defined data strategy enables the establishment of policies, standards, and processes necessary for effective data governance. It guides the establishment of roles and responsibilities, communication plans, and the means to measure success. Additionally, having a clear data strategy helps in prioritizing initiatives, identifying necessary resources, and ensuring stakeholder buy-in, all of which are vital for the successful implementation of data governance.

Although other aspects like establishing a data management office, creating effective data lineage, and establishing data quality metrics are important components of data governance, they are best implemented within the framework of a clear data strategy. This strategy informs and supports those areas, making it a cornerstone of successful data governance.
